+static void hns_roce_update_cq_cons_index(struct hns_roce_context *ctx,
+					  struct hns_roce_cq *cq)
+{
+	struct hns_roce_cq_db cq_db;
+
+	cq_db.u32_4 = 0;
+	cq_db.u32_8 = 0;
+
+	roce_set_bit(cq_db.u32_8, CQ_DB_U32_8_HW_SYNC_S, 1);
+	roce_set_field(cq_db.u32_8, CQ_DB_U32_8_CMD_M, CQ_DB_U32_8_CMD_S, 3);
+	roce_set_field(cq_db.u32_8, CQ_DB_U32_8_CMD_MDF_M,
+		       CQ_DB_U32_8_CMD_MDF_S, 0);
+	roce_set_field(cq_db.u32_8, CQ_DB_U32_8_CQN_M, CQ_DB_U32_8_CQN_S,
+		       cq->cqn);
+	roce_set_field(cq_db.u32_4, CQ_DB_U32_4_CONS_IDX_M,
+		       CQ_DB_U32_4_CONS_IDX_S,
+		       cq->cons_index & ((cq->cq_depth << 1) - 1));
+
+	hns_roce_write64((uint32_t *)&cq_db, ctx, ROCEE_DB_OTHERS_L_0_REG);
+}
+
+static void hns_roce_handle_error_cqe(struct hns_roce_cqe *cqe,
+				      struct ibv_wc *wc)
+{
+	switch (roce_get_field(cqe->cqe_byte_4,
+			       CQE_BYTE_4_STATUS_OF_THE_OPERATION_M,
+			       CQE_BYTE_4_STATUS_OF_THE_OPERATION_S) &
+		HNS_ROCE_CQE_STATUS_MASK) {
+		fprintf(stderr, PFX "error cqe!\n");
+	case HNS_ROCE_CQE_SYNDROME_LOCAL_LENGTH_ERR:
+		wc->status = IBV_WC_LOC_LEN_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_LOCAL_QP_OP_ERR:
+		wc->status = IBV_WC_LOC_QP_OP_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_LOCAL_PROT_ERR:
+		wc->status = IBV_WC_LOC_PROT_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_WR_FLUSH_ERR:
+		wc->status = IBV_WC_WR_FLUSH_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_MEM_MANAGE_OPERATE_ERR:
+		wc->status = IBV_WC_MW_BIND_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_BAD_RESP_ERR:
+		wc->status = IBV_WC_BAD_RESP_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_LOCAL_ACCESS_ERR:
+		wc->status = IBV_WC_LOC_ACCESS_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_REMOTE_INVAL_REQ_ERR:
+		wc->status = IBV_WC_REM_INV_REQ_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_REMOTE_ACCESS_ERR:
+		wc->status = IBV_WC_REM_ACCESS_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_REMOTE_OP_ERR:
+		wc->status = IBV_WC_REM_OP_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_TRANSPORT_RETRY_EXC_ERR:
+		wc->status = IBV_WC_RETRY_EXC_ERR;
+		break;
+	case HNS_ROCE_CQE_SYNDROME_RNR_RETRY_EXC_ERR:
+		wc->status = IBV_WC_RNR_RETRY_EXC_ERR;
+		break;
+	default:
+		wc->status = IBV_WC_GENERAL_ERR;
+		break;
+	}
+}
+
+static struct hns_roce_cqe *get_cqe(struct hns_roce_cq *cq, int entry)
+{
+	return cq->buf.buf + entry * HNS_ROCE_CQE_ENTRY_SIZE;
+}
+
+static void *get_sw_cqe(struct hns_roce_cq *cq, int n)
+{
+	struct hns_roce_cqe *cqe = get_cqe(cq, n & cq->ibv_cq.cqe);
+
+	return (!!(roce_get_bit(cqe->cqe_byte_4, CQE_BYTE_4_OWNER_S)) ^
+		!!(n & (cq->ibv_cq.cqe + 1))) ? cqe : NULL;
+}

+static int hns_roce_v1_poll_one(struct hns_roce_cq *cq,
+				struct hns_roce_qp **cur_qp, struct ibv_wc *wc)
+{
+	uint32_t qpn;
+	int is_send;
+	uint16_t wqe_ctr;
+	uint32_t local_qpn;
+	struct hns_roce_wq *wq = NULL;
+	struct hns_roce_cqe *cqe = NULL;
+	struct hns_roce_wqe_ctrl_seg *sq_wqe = NULL;
+
+	/* According to CI, find the relative cqe */
+	cqe = next_cqe_sw(cq);
+	if (!cqe)
+		return CQ_EMPTY;
+
+	/* Get the next cqe, CI will be added gradually */
+	++cq->cons_index;
+
+	rmb();
+
+	qpn = roce_get_field(cqe->cqe_byte_16, CQE_BYTE_16_LOCAL_QPN_M,
+			     CQE_BYTE_16_LOCAL_QPN_S);
+
+	is_send = (roce_get_bit(cqe->cqe_byte_4, CQE_BYTE_4_SQ_RQ_FLAG_S) ==
+		   HNS_ROCE_CQE_IS_SQ);
+
+	local_qpn = roce_get_field(cqe->cqe_byte_16, CQE_BYTE_16_LOCAL_QPN_M,
+				   CQE_BYTE_16_LOCAL_QPN_S);
+
+	/* if qp is zero, it will not get the correct qpn */
+	if (!*cur_qp ||
+	    (local_qpn & HNS_ROCE_CQE_QPN_MASK) != (*cur_qp)->ibv_qp.qp_num) {
+
+		*cur_qp = hns_roce_find_qp(to_hr_ctx(cq->ibv_cq.context),
+					   qpn & 0xffffff);
+		if (!*cur_qp) {
+			fprintf(stderr, PFX "can't find qp!\n");
+			return CQ_POLL_ERR;
+		}
+	}
+	wc->qp_num = qpn & 0xffffff;
+
+	if (is_send) {
+		wq = &(*cur_qp)->sq;
+		/*
+		 * if sq_signal_bits is 1, the tail pointer first update to
+		 * the wqe corresponding the current cqe
+		 */
+		if ((*cur_qp)->sq_signal_bits) {
+			wqe_ctr = (uint16_t)(roce_get_field(cqe->cqe_byte_4,
+						CQE_BYTE_4_WQE_INDEX_M,
+						CQE_BYTE_4_WQE_INDEX_S));
+			/*
+			 * wq->tail will plus a positive number every time,
+			 * when wq->tail exceeds 32b, it is 0 and acc
+			 */
+			wq->tail += (wqe_ctr - (uint16_t) wq->tail) &
+				    (wq->wqe_cnt - 1);
+		}
+		/* write the wr_id of wq into the wc */
+		wc->wr_id = wq->wrid[wq->tail & (wq->wqe_cnt - 1)];
+		++wq->tail;
+	} else {
+		wq = &(*cur_qp)->rq;
+		wc->wr_id = wq->wrid[wq->tail & (wq->wqe_cnt - 1)];
+		++wq->tail;
+	}
+
+	/*
+	 * HW maintains wc status, set the err type and directly return, after
+	 * generated the incorrect CQE
+	 */
+	if (roce_get_field(cqe->cqe_byte_4,
+	    CQE_BYTE_4_STATUS_OF_THE_OPERATION_M,
+	    CQE_BYTE_4_STATUS_OF_THE_OPERATION_S) != HNS_ROCE_CQE_SUCCESS) {
+		hns_roce_handle_error_cqe(cqe, wc);
+		return CQ_OK;
+	}
+	wc->status = IBV_WC_SUCCESS;
+
+	/*
+	 * According to the opcode type of cqe, mark the opcode and other
+	 * information of wc
+	 */
+	if (is_send) {
+		/* Get opcode and flag before update the tail point for send */
+		sq_wqe = (struct hns_roce_wqe_ctrl_seg *)
+			 (uint64_t)get_send_wqe(*cur_qp,
+						roce_get_field(cqe->cqe_byte_4,
+						CQE_BYTE_4_WQE_INDEX_M,
+						CQE_BYTE_4_WQE_INDEX_S));
+		switch (sq_wqe->flag & HNS_ROCE_WQE_OPCODE_MASK) {
+		case HNS_ROCE_WQE_OPCODE_SEND:
+			wc->opcode = IBV_WC_SEND;
+			break;
+		case HNS_ROCE_WQE_OPCODE_RDMA_READ:
+			wc->opcode = IBV_WC_RDMA_READ;
+			wc->byte_len = cqe->byte_cnt;
+			break;
+		case HNS_ROCE_WQE_OPCODE_RDMA_WRITE:
+			wc->opcode = IBV_WC_RDMA_WRITE;
+			break;
+		case HNS_ROCE_WQE_OPCODE_BIND_MW2:
+			wc->opcode = IBV_WC_BIND_MW;
+			break;
+		default:
+			wc->status = IBV_WC_GENERAL_ERR;
+			break;
+		}
+		wc->wc_flags = (sq_wqe->flag & HNS_ROCE_WQE_IMM ?
+				IBV_WC_WITH_IMM : 0);
+	} else {
+		/* Get opcode and flag in rq&srq */
+		wc->byte_len = (cqe->byte_cnt);
+
+		switch (roce_get_field(cqe->cqe_byte_4,
+				       CQE_BYTE_4_OPERATION_TYPE_M,
+				       CQE_BYTE_4_OPERATION_TYPE_S) &
+			HNS_ROCE_CQE_OPCODE_MASK) {
+		case HNS_ROCE_OPCODE_RDMA_WITH_IMM_RECEIVE:
+			wc->opcode   = IBV_WC_RECV_RDMA_WITH_IMM;
+			wc->wc_flags = IBV_WC_WITH_IMM;
+			wc->imm_data = cqe->immediate_data;
+			break;
+		case HNS_ROCE_OPCODE_SEND_DATA_RECEIVE:
+			if (roce_get_bit(cqe->cqe_byte_4,
+					 CQE_BYTE_4_IMMEDIATE_DATA_FLAG_S)) {
+				wc->opcode   = IBV_WC_RECV;
+				wc->wc_flags = IBV_WC_WITH_IMM;
+				wc->imm_data = cqe->immediate_data;
+			} else {
+				wc->opcode   = IBV_WC_RECV;
+				wc->wc_flags = 0;
+			}
+			break;
+		default:
+			wc->status = IBV_WC_GENERAL_ERR;
+			break;
+		}
+	}
+
+	return CQ_OK;
+}
+
+static int hns_roce_u_v1_poll_cq(struct ibv_cq *ibvcq, int ne,
+				 struct ibv_wc *wc)
+{
+	int npolled;
+	int err = CQ_OK;
+	struct hns_roce_qp *qp = NULL;
+	struct hns_roce_cq *cq = to_hr_cq(ibvcq);
+	struct hns_roce_context *ctx = to_hr_ctx(ibvcq->context);
+	struct hns_roce_device *dev = to_hr_dev(ibvcq->context->device);
+
+	pthread_spin_lock(&cq->lock);
+
+	for (npolled = 0; npolled < ne; ++npolled) {
+		err = hns_roce_v1_poll_one(cq, &qp, wc + npolled);
+		if (err != CQ_OK)
+			break;
+	}
+
+	if (npolled) {
+		if (dev->hw_version == HNS_ROCE_HW_VER1) {
+			*cq->set_ci_db = (unsigned short)(cq->cons_index &
+					 ((cq->cq_depth << 1) - 1));
+			mb();
+		}
+
+		hns_roce_update_cq_cons_index(ctx, cq);
+	}
+
+	pthread_spin_unlock(&cq->lock);
+
+	return err == CQ_POLL_ERR ? err : npolled;
+}

+static void __hns_roce_v1_cq_clean(struct hns_roce_cq *cq, uint32_t qpn,
+				   struct hns_roce_srq *srq)
+{
+	int nfreed = 0;
+	uint32_t prod_index;
+	uint8_t owner_bit = 0;
+	struct hns_roce_cqe *cqe, *dest;
+	struct hns_roce_context *ctx = to_hr_ctx(cq->ibv_cq.context);
+
+	for (prod_index = cq->cons_index; get_sw_cqe(cq, prod_index);
+	     ++prod_index)
+		if (prod_index == cq->cons_index + cq->ibv_cq.cqe)
+			break;
+
+	while ((int) --prod_index - (int) cq->cons_index >= 0) {
+		cqe = get_cqe(cq, prod_index & cq->ibv_cq.cqe);
+		if ((roce_get_field(cqe->cqe_byte_16, CQE_BYTE_16_LOCAL_QPN_M,
+			      CQE_BYTE_16_LOCAL_QPN_S) & 0xffffff) == qpn) {
+			++nfreed;
+		} else if (nfreed) {
+			dest = get_cqe(cq,
+				       (prod_index + nfreed) & cq->ibv_cq.cqe);
+			owner_bit = roce_get_bit(dest->cqe_byte_4,
+						 CQE_BYTE_4_OWNER_S);
+			memcpy(dest, cqe, sizeof(*cqe));
+			roce_set_bit(dest->cqe_byte_4, CQE_BYTE_4_OWNER_S,
+				     owner_bit);
+		}
+	}
+
+	if (nfreed) {
+		cq->cons_index += nfreed;
+		wmb();
+		hns_roce_update_cq_cons_index(ctx, cq);
+	}
+}
+
+static void hns_roce_v1_cq_clean(struct hns_roce_cq *cq, unsigned int qpn,
+				 struct hns_roce_srq *srq)
+{
+	pthread_spin_lock(&cq->lock);
+	__hns_roce_v1_cq_clean(cq, qpn, srq);
+	pthread_spin_unlock(&cq->lock);
+}

+static int hns_roce_u_v1_post_send(struct ibv_qp *ibvqp, struct ibv_send_wr *wr,
+				   struct ibv_send_wr **bad_wr)
+{
+	unsigned int ind;
+	void *wqe;
+	int nreq;
+	int ps_opcode, i;
+	int ret = 0;
+	struct hns_roce_wqe_ctrl_seg *ctrl = NULL;
+	struct hns_roce_wqe_data_seg *dseg = NULL;
+	struct hns_roce_qp *qp = to_hr_qp(ibvqp);
+	struct hns_roce_context *ctx = to_hr_ctx(ibvqp->context);
+
+	pthread_spin_lock(&qp->sq.lock);
+
+	/* check that state is OK to post send */
+	ind = qp->sq.head;
+
+	for (nreq = 0; wr; ++nreq, wr = wr->next) {
+		if (hns_roce_wq_overflow(&qp->sq, nreq,
+					 to_hr_cq(qp->ibv_qp.send_cq))) {
+			ret = -1;
+			*bad_wr = wr;
+			goto out;
+		}
+		if (wr->num_sge > qp->sq.max_gs) {
+			ret = -1;
+			*bad_wr = wr;
+			printf("wr->num_sge(<=%d) = %d, check failed!\r\n",
+				qp->sq.max_gs, wr->num_sge);
+			goto out;
+		}
+
+		ctrl = wqe = get_send_wqe(qp, ind & (qp->sq.wqe_cnt - 1));
+		memset(ctrl, 0, sizeof(struct hns_roce_wqe_ctrl_seg));
+
+		qp->sq.wrid[ind & (qp->sq.wqe_cnt - 1)] = wr->wr_id;
+		for (i = 0; i < wr->num_sge; i++)
+			ctrl->msg_length += wr->sg_list[i].length;
+
+
+		ctrl->flag |= ((wr->send_flags & IBV_SEND_SIGNALED) ?
+				HNS_ROCE_WQE_CQ_NOTIFY : 0) |
+			      (wr->send_flags & IBV_SEND_SOLICITED ?
+				HNS_ROCE_WQE_SE : 0) |
+			      ((wr->opcode == IBV_WR_SEND_WITH_IMM ||
+			       wr->opcode == IBV_WR_RDMA_WRITE_WITH_IMM) ?
+				HNS_ROCE_WQE_IMM : 0) |
+			      (wr->send_flags & IBV_SEND_FENCE ?
+				HNS_ROCE_WQE_FENCE : 0);
+
+		if (wr->opcode == IBV_WR_SEND_WITH_IMM ||
+		    wr->opcode == IBV_WR_RDMA_WRITE_WITH_IMM)
+			ctrl->imm_data = wr->imm_data;
+
+		wqe += sizeof(struct hns_roce_wqe_ctrl_seg);
+
+		/* set remote addr segment */
+		switch (ibvqp->qp_type) {
+		case IBV_QPT_RC:
+			switch (wr->opcode) {
+			case IBV_WR_RDMA_READ:
+				ps_opcode = HNS_ROCE_WQE_OPCODE_RDMA_READ;
+				set_raddr_seg(wqe, wr->wr.rdma.remote_addr,
+					      wr->wr.rdma.rkey);
+				break;
+			case IBV_WR_RDMA_WRITE:
+			case IBV_WR_RDMA_WRITE_WITH_IMM:
+				ps_opcode = HNS_ROCE_WQE_OPCODE_RDMA_WRITE;
+				set_raddr_seg(wqe, wr->wr.rdma.remote_addr,
+					      wr->wr.rdma.rkey);
+				break;
+			case IBV_WR_SEND:
+			case IBV_WR_SEND_WITH_IMM:
+				ps_opcode = HNS_ROCE_WQE_OPCODE_SEND;
+				break;
+			case IBV_WR_ATOMIC_CMP_AND_SWP:
+			case IBV_WR_ATOMIC_FETCH_AND_ADD:
+			default:
+				ps_opcode = HNS_ROCE_WQE_OPCODE_MASK;
+				break;
+			}
+			ctrl->flag |= (ps_opcode);
+			wqe  += sizeof(struct hns_roce_wqe_raddr_seg);
+			break;
+		case IBV_QPT_UC:
+		case IBV_QPT_UD:
+		default:
+			break;
+		}
+
+		dseg = wqe;
+
+		/* Inline */
+		if (wr->send_flags & IBV_SEND_INLINE && wr->num_sge) {
+			if (ctrl->msg_length > qp->max_inline_data) {
+				ret = -1;
+				*bad_wr = wr;
+				printf("inline data len(1-32)=%d, send_flags = 0x%x, check failed!\r\n",
+					wr->send_flags, ctrl->msg_length);
+				return ret;
+			}
+
+			for (i = 0; i < wr->num_sge; i++) {
+				memcpy(wqe,
+				     ((void *) (uintptr_t) wr->sg_list[i].addr),
+				     wr->sg_list[i].length);
+				wqe = wqe + wr->sg_list[i].length;
+			}
+
+			ctrl->flag |= HNS_ROCE_WQE_INLINE;
+		} else {
+			/* set sge */
+			for (i = 0; i < wr->num_sge; i++)
+				set_data_seg(dseg+i, wr->sg_list + i);
+
+			ctrl->flag |= wr->num_sge << HNS_ROCE_WQE_SGE_NUM_BIT;
+		}
+
+		ind++;
+	}
+
+out:
+	/* Set DB return */
+	if (likely(nreq)) {
+		qp->sq.head += nreq;
+		wmb();
+
+		hns_roce_update_sq_head(ctx, qp->ibv_qp.qp_num,
+				qp->port_num - 1, qp->sl,
+				qp->sq.head & ((qp->sq.wqe_cnt << 1) - 1));
+	}
+
+	pthread_spin_unlock(&qp->sq.lock);
+
+	return ret;
+}
